Cape Breton Foods: French: île du Cap-Breton, Scottish Gaelic: Eilean Cheap Breatuinn, Mi'kmaq: U'namakika. A large island on the Atlantic coast of North America, and part of the province of Nova Scotia, Canada physically separated from the peninsular Nova Scotian mainland by the Strait of Canso.

Cape Breton Food Producers and Processors Association is committed to:

  • Raising the public awareness and interest in the Food Industry of Cape Breton Island by promoting a growth industry through forward thinking.
  • Instilling confidence that resource-base industries can proficiently adapt to use information technology and be a integral part of the knowledge-base economy.
  • Proactively advance the competitive advantage of Cape Breton Island food producers and processors in both domestic and export sales marketplaces.
